@onedayatatime73 - my dd was obsessed with American girl dolls and we caved (2, maybe 3 years ago) and bought a ‘truly me’ one. They are really expensive, but we bought from my doll boutique, I’ve had a look now though and not sure the website exists anymore? Much better buying from the Uk as the customs and import charges are eye watering.

The ‘our generation’ range at smyths fits the American girl dolls though, and the accessories are really cute so my dd mostly has those playsets with her American girl doll. (They sell OG in target in the US so a lot of videos on YouTube showing American girl dolls have the our generation stuff in them, so dd was really happy with that)
She does also have an our generation doll, and although the quality is vastly better from American girl, my dd doesn’t really care and loves them both just as much.

There’s also designa friend, Sindy, journey girls and a few others a similar size, but personally I think the our generation ones are miles better, and have very cute accessories and playset add ons.
